Obtaining data for your personal injury case
It isn’t always easy to find the right information for your personal injury case following a semitruck accident. Most people don’t understand what evidence is essential or how to protect it.
The primary way to prove your liability claim will be electronic information retrieved from the truck’s «black box». A knowledgeable lawyer should be retained should you be injured in a big-rig crash.
Many commercial trucks have an event data recorder. Also known as»blackbox «blackbox» or EDR these devices can be present on a variety of commercial trucks. These devices are made to record car crashes for a long period of time.
These could include the time the driver was at the wheel along with the speed of the truck, as well as the place where the crash took place. The information can be used to prove the liability of the other party by an Los Angeles truck accident lawyer.

Seek medical attention immediately following an accident
In the event of a medical emergency, seeking immediate medical attention after a semi truck accident attorneys truck accident can be crucial to your recovery. In the event of more serious injuries delayed treatment can make symptoms worse. You could lose your right to claim if you don’t seek medical treatment.
There are many ways you can take action following an accident on the road to ensure you receive the proper medical treatment. First, collect the insurance information of the other person. This will allow you to document your accident. It is also important to share contact information and job information. You shouldn’t admit fault in the accident However, you must provide all the relevant details. You should also request a copy of the police report.
Note down all details. You should also take pictures of the scene of the accident as well as the damage to your vehicle. You should also obtain the contact details of any witnesses. You should note down what you believe is the cause of the crash as well as any other factors that could have affected your driving skills. Keep the exact record of any medical expenses you’ve incurred as a result of the accident.
Finally, you should obtain an official medical report. This will provide you with complete evidence of your injury and help you obtain reimbursement for medical treatment.
If you feel in pain or suspect that you could be injured, you should seek immediate medical attention. This can be hard to accomplish following a trucking accident because your adrenaline can conceal your initial symptoms. Many victims of accidents with trucks don’t realize they have been injured until the following day.
It is possible to request an extensive medical exam at your doctor’s office. This could include X-rays, MRIs as well as other internal medical examinations. This will help you determine the cause of late-appearing injuries to your trucking accident.
